20:11
Enhance the command-line shell to be in auto-explain mode by default. It is no longer necessary to use the ".explain" command to put the shell into a mode where the EXPLAIN output is formatted nicely. That now happens automatically. (check-in: 751915cb7e user: drh tags: trunk)

16:09
Code simplification: ALTER TABLE ADD COLUMN always upgrades the file_format to 4 if is not there already. No need to upgrade to only 2 or 3 since format 4 has now been supported for over 10 years. (check-in: e1d8ec8554 user: drh tags: trunk)

02:12
Make sure every co-routines has its own set of temporary registers and does not share temporaries, since a co-routine might expect the content of a temporary register to be preserved across an OP_Yield. Proposed fix for ticket [d06a25c84454a]. (check-in: ca72be8618 user: drh tags: trunk)

18:19
Do not report corruption if the the db size header field is greater than the file size on disk unless the two change-counter header fields are identical. Fix for ticket [89b8c9ac54]. (check-in: 00c4596f0b user: dan tags: trunk)

22:13
SUM never gives an error. An integer result is returned for exact results and a floating point result is returned for approximate results. Tickets #1664, #1669, and #1670. (CVS 3066) (check-in: 9e04f8fdf1 user: drh tags: trunk)
